Set in an elevated position along a sought-after road, this beautifully presented four-bedroom detached family home combines 1930s character with stylish modern living, all just a short stroll from Caterham’s vibrant town centre and mainline station.
Recently redecorated throughout, the property offers a bright and spacious layout designed with both family life and entertaining in mind. At its heart is an impressive open-plan reception room, creating a seamless and sociable space having incorporated the old conservatory in to an insulated part of the living room, complemented by a separate reception room for added flexibility. The well-appointed kitchen/breakfast room, along with a convenient utility area and downstairs WC, enhances the home’s practicality. Upstairs, four bedrooms are served by a sleek, modern family bathroom.
Touches of the home’s original charm-such as feature fireplaces-add warmth and character against a backdrop of fresh, neutral décor.
Outside
Outside, the east-facing rear garden is a true highlight: A level and private space featuring a patio area perfect for outdoor dining, bordered by established shrubs and planting for a peaceful, enclosed feel.
To the front, a detached garage provides additional storage or parking.
Situation
Tillingdown Hill is within a short distance (1 mile) of Caterham town centre and railway station. Caterham has a good range of shops including Church Walk and a Waitrose and Morrisons supermarket. The M25 can be joined at Junction 6 about 3 miles away. There are local schools in both the state and private sectors including nearby Caterham School.
Train services: Caterham Station (1 mile) is in Zone 6 and has direct services to London Bridge and Victoria in about 40 minutes.
